Turnagain Arm Coastal Journey Highlights Alaska’s Scenic Wilderness and Wildlife
A scenic journey from Anchorage along the dramatic coastline of Turnagain Arm offers travelers an unforgettable introduction to Alaska’s coastal wilderness. Following the renowned Seward Highway, the route unfolds through a striking landscape where towering mountains rise above shimmering tidal waters, creating a constantly changing panorama of natural beauty.
Along the way, travelers pause at iconic viewpoints such as Beluga Point and Bird Point, both known for their sweeping vistas and peaceful coastal atmosphere. These stops provide ideal opportunities for photography, fresh air, and quiet reflection while surrounded by rugged cliffs, wide valleys, and the dynamic tides of the inlet. Wildlife sightings are also possible, with moose, eagles, and other native species occasionally appearing in the surrounding wilderness.
The journey continues toward the Alaska Wildlife Conservation Center, a respected sanctuary dedicated to the rehabilitation and protection of Alaska’s native animals. Situated near the entrance of scenic Portage Valley, the center offers spacious natural habitats where visitors can observe species such as bears, bison, elk, caribou, muskox, and birds of prey while learning about conservation efforts.
Throughout the visit, guests gain a deeper appreciation for Alaska’s wildlife heritage and the ongoing work required to protect it. Seasonal opportunities to observe young animals under care add an additional layer of insight and emotional connection. Combining breathtaking scenery, wildlife encounters, and educational value, this relaxed coastal tour provides a rewarding and memorable way to experience Alaska’s natural wonders.
